Forward Sale of St. Mungo Avenue, Glasgow

 

Watkin Jones plc (AIM:WJG), a leading UK developer and constructor of multi occupancy property assets, with a focus on the student accommodation sector, announces today that it has forward sold its development in St. Mungo Avenue, Glasgow to a new institutional investor for an undisclosed fee.

 

The St. Mungo Avenue development is a 1.07 acre site which occupies a prominent position at the corner of St. Mungo Avenue and St. James Road to the east of Glasgow City centre and in close proximity to the University of Strathclyde, Glasgow Caledonian University and the City of Glasgow College.  The seven storey 349 bed scheme (176 cluster bedrooms and 173 studios) is due for delivery in August 2018, ahead of the 2018-19 academic year. 

 

Mark Watkin Jones, Chief Executive Officer of Watkin Jones plc, said:  "We are delighted to announce today that we have forward sold to a new institutional investor our St. Mungo's scheme in Glasgow.  With three main universities in Glasgow servicing more than 65,000 higher education students there is significant demand for accommodation within the City.  The demand for purpose built student accommodation is higher than levels seen at comparable UK university cities, and we are delighted to be developing in Glasgow.

 

"The scheme will be developed to a high specification including excellent shared space and amenities including a cinema room, two common room areas, gym and roof terrace.  Glasgow ranks amongst the top ten UK university towns and on completion of St. Mungo Avenue, Watkin Jones will have delivered over 3,000 beds across six schemes in Glasgow since 2011."

Notes to Editors

 

Watkin Jones is a leading UK developer and constructor of multi occupancy property assets, with a focus on the student accommodation sector.  The Group has strong relationships with institutional investors, and a good reputation for successful, on-time-delivery of high quality developments.  Since 1999, Watkin Jones has delivered over 31,800 student beds across 98 sites, making it a key player and leader in the UK purpose built student accommodation market.  In addition, Watkin Jones has been responsible for over 50 residential developments, ranging from starter homes to executive housing and apartments.

 

The Group's competitive advantage lies in its experienced management team and business model, which enables it to offer an end to end solution for investors, delivered entirely in-house with minimal reliance on third parties, across the entire life cycle of an asset.  Key components of the business model are:

 

·     Site identification - extensive experience of site identification and acquisition facilitates high quality sites being acquired;

·     Planning consents - in depth knowledge and experience of the planning consent process specific to this type of asset facilitates high success rates on planning applications;

·     In-house construction and delivery - in-house construction expertise, management and delivery limits reliance on third parties and, together with favourable contractual relationships with key suppliers, enhances control of cost;

·     Funding structure - forward sale model reduces risk for Watkin Jones and provides security and visibility of the asset pipeline for investors.  The Group has strong relationships with blue chip investors, including a number that are repeat investors in Watkin Jones developments; and

·     Asset management - dedicated property management division provides a continued service solution to investors post development completion and completes the 'end to end' business model.
